CONMED (CNMD), a global medical technology company specializing in surgical and orthopedic care solutions, recently released its official the previous quarter earnings results. The reported figures include a GAAP earnings per share (EPS) of $1.43 and total quarterly revenue of $1,374,724,000 for the period. These results represent the latest available operational data for the firm as of this month. The the previous quarter performance reflects demand across CONMED’s three core operating segments

Management Commentary

During the public earnings call held following the results release, CONMED’s leadership team discussed key drivers of the the previous quarter performance. Leadership noted that ongoing investments in product development over recent periods contributed to stronger adoption of the company’s latest orthopedic implant systems and digital surgical navigation tools, particularly among outpatient surgical centers that have seen steady patient volume trends in recent months. Management also highlighted improvements to the firm’s global supply chain network, which helped reduce product delivery lead times and support higher customer retention rates across key North American and European markets during the quarter. The team also addressed ongoing cost optimization efforts that supported operating margin performance during the period, without providing specific forward margin commitments during the call. Leadership also noted that the company’s international sales footprint held up well despite fluctuating foreign exchange trends across emerging markets in recent months. Forward Guidance

CONMED’s leadership shared preliminary qualitative outlook commentary during the earnings call, avoiding specific quantitative projections for upcoming periods. The team noted that they see potential for continued growth in demand for minimally invasive surgical solutions in upcoming months, driven by long-term trends towards lower-cost outpatient care delivery and rising rates of elective orthopedic procedures. Leadership also flagged several potential headwinds that could impact future performance, including global macroeconomic volatility that may affect healthcare system spending, extended regulatory review timelines for new product launches in some markets, and fluctuations in raw material costs that could put pressure on operating expenses. The company confirmed plans to continue allocating a significant share of capital to research and development and targeted strategic partnerships to expand its product portfolio, while also pursuing additional operational efficiency measures to offset potential cost pressures. All shared outlook is preliminary and subject to adjustment based on evolving market conditions. Market Reaction

Following the public release of the the previous quarter earnings results, CNMD shares traded with normal trading activity in recent sessions, with trading volumes roughly in line with the trailing 30-day average for the stock. Sell-side analysts covering CONMED have published updated research notes following the release, with most noting that the reported results align with their prior assumptions for the company’s underlying business trajectory. Some analysts have highlighted the company’s growing product pipeline as a potential long-term growth driver for the business, while others have noted that near-term macroeconomic uncertainty and sector-wide healthcare spending trends could create short-term price volatility for CNMD shares in upcoming weeks. Market data shows that investor sentiment towards the broader medical device sector has been mixed in recent weeks, as market participants weigh positive long-term demographic trends supporting healthcare demand against concerns over near-term spending constraints among public and private healthcare systems.
